Transaction ddbe18a91ab2f7c71105cba921f85c643d4317340453509b9862d53e5d5ae076

2 Input
2 Outputs
  • ddbe18a91ab2f7c71105cba921f85c643d4317340453509b9862d53e5d5ae076:0
  • value  13000000
    address  1H3SFDosru33WoPNzxPsPyCcg2dR4tAtAC
  • ddbe18a91ab2f7c71105cba921f85c643d4317340453509b9862d53e5d5ae076:1
  • value  7990083
    address  13s9iizYog7LpyLo3LCdX3tBuunrjvSiT2